Safety
While bunk beds are a fantastic alternative to save space for children but they also pose security concerns. Select a bunk bed that is designed in accordance with CPSC standards (Consumer Product Safety Commission). It should also have been tested by a third party lab. Find beds that have guardrails on the sides and on the bottom, and a sturdy, solid ladder. It should be free of hooks that can potentially strangle children and should not require tools to put it together or remove it.
Safety is a major consideration when buying bunk beds, as children tend to climb them frequently. A quality bunk bed will include guardrails at every level to ensure that children do not fall off while asleep. It should also feature a sturdy, solid frame that can support two adults without sagging or breaking. It's an excellent idea for you to teach your children how to use the ladder and insist that the top bunk beds for kids on sale isn't intended to be a space to play. It's also a good idea to have parents set guidelines about what is and can't be hung from the guard rails on the top bunk, as items like scarves and belts can easily strangle children.
Some bunk beds come with a staircase instead of a ladder which is more secure and easier to climb for kids who are young. They are more expensive than ladders and require more space in the bedroom. Some stairs may even have built-in storage or handrails making them an appealing option than standard ladder models.
A few bunk beds for kids have additional features available, such as a slide that extends from the upper bed. While these are fun for children, they're recommended for older children and should only be used under adult supervision.
